Understanding Embedded Touch Screen Monitors

Embedded touch screen monitors are not just another display technology; they are a revolution in how we interact with screens. These monitors are integrated into various systems, from entertainment centers to industrial machinery, offering a range of features that set them apart from traditional monitors. Key attributes include durability, zero-bezel designs, and ergonomic builds, making them suitable for diverse environments. Unlike standalone monitors, embedded screens often come with advanced connectivity options, allowing them to interface with other devices seamlessly. This integration capability enhances their utility, making them an essential component in any workspace.
